Phibro Animal Health Earnings Call Summary

Earnings Call Date:Aug 26, 2026

Earnings Call Sentiment Positive
The call communicated strong operating momentum and record full-year results—double-digit revenue growth, a 39% increase in adjusted EBITDA, successful integration of the MFA acquisition, and tangible benefits from the Phibro Forward program. Management provided conservative but constructive FY2027 guidance while reserving downside for specific risks (notably the regulatory status of virginiamycin in Brazil). Cash generation was constrained in FY2026 by a large inventory build and CapEx requirements, and near-term impacts include a planned plant closure with one-time costs and a weak Performance Products segment. Overall, the positive operating performance, sizable EBITDA gains, and strategic integration successes outweigh the manageable near-term headwinds and uncertainties.

Company Guidance
Phibro guided to fiscal 2027 net sales of $1.55–$1.60 billion (growth 2%–5%, midpoint ~$1.575B), total adjusted EBITDA of $258–$268 million (growth 1%–5%, midpoint ~$263M), adjusted diluted EPS of $3.41–$3.59 (midpoint ~$3.50) and adjusted net income of $140–$147 million (growth 6%–11%, midpoint ~$143.5M) with an adjusted effective tax rate of ~20%. The company assumed minimal Virginiamycin sales in Brazil (FY26 Virginiamycin sales were ~$27M) and expects Q1 EBIT to be negative before turning positive for the rest of the year; FY27 inventory build is expected to be ~$25–$30M (vs. $86.3M in FY26). Management said FY26 results included $10M of free cash flow (operating cash flow $69M, CapEx $59M), expects higher CapEx in FY27 to expand vaccine capacity, and projects the Chicago Heights closure will incur roughly $10M of one‑time cash costs plus ~$10M CapEx but ultimately yield ~$15–$20M of annual EBITDA benefit (mostly in FY28+); gross and net leverage at Q4 were 2.9x and 2.6x (based on $738M total debt / $656M net debt and $255M trailing‑12‑month adjusted EBITDA).

Phibro Animal Health Financial Statement Overview

Summary
Income statement strength is clear (2026 revenue up sharply to ~$1.52B, net income nearly doubled to ~$100M, and margins expanded), and the balance sheet is improving (debt-to-equity down to ~1.54x with strong ~25.9% ROE). However, cash flow is the major drag: the provided cash flow scoring indicates the weakest quality/consistency and reports 2026 operating and free cash flow as 0, raising concern about earnings-to-cash conversion and leverage resilience.
